Assessing Photoreceptor Structure in Retinitis Pigmentosa and Usher Syndrome
The purpose of this study was to examine cone photoreceptor structure in retinitis pigmentosa (RP) and Usher syndrome using confocal and nonconfocal split-detector adaptive optics scanning light ophthalmoscopy (AOSLO).
